What is a Technical Drafting job?

A Technical Drafting job involves creating detailed technical drawings and plans used in construction, manufacturing, engineering, or product design. Drafters use computer-aided design (CAD) software and traditional drafting techniques to produce accurate diagrams, layouts, and blueprints. They collaborate with engineers, architects, and designers to ensure that drawings meet technical specifications and industry standards. Technical drafters specialize in fields such as mechanical, electrical, civil, or architectural drafting, depending on the industry they work in.

Will CAD drafters be replaced by AI?

CAD drafters perform detailed technical drawings and design documentation, and while AI tools can assist with automating repetitive tasks, they are unlikely to fully replace skilled drafters in complex or creative aspects of the job. Human expertise remains essential for interpreting design intent and ensuring accuracy in technical drawings. Proficiency in CAD software and understanding of engineering principles are important for the role's continued relevance.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Technical Drafting position, and why are they important?

To thrive in Technical Drafting, you need strong skills in technical drawing, spatial visualization, attention to detail, and generally an associate degree or certification in drafting or a related field. Familiarity with industry-standard CAD software such as AutoCAD, SolidWorks, or Revit, as well as knowledge of building codes and drafting standards, is essential. Strong organizational skills, communication abilities, and adaptability will set you apart in collaborating with engineers, architects, and other stakeholders. These competencies are critical for producing precise, compliant technical drawings that support successful project outcomes.

What does a typical day look like for someone working in Technical Drafting?

A typical day in Technical Drafting often involves creating or updating technical drawings and blueprints based on specifications from engineers or architects, using CAD software to ensure accuracy and adherence to standards. Draftspeople may participate in team meetings to coordinate design changes, review project requirements, and address feedback from project leads. Collaboration with other departments or field personnel is common to clarify technical details and resolve conflicts in design. This role balances focused, independent computer work with regular communication, making time management and adaptability important for meeting deadlines and project goals.
